Historic 2026 DICK'S All-American Classic Set for Citizens Bank Park



Perfect Game, recognized as the foremost youth baseball and softball platform globally, has exciting news for fans of the sport! The 2026 DICK'S All-American Classic is officially slated to take place at Citizens Bank Park in Philadelphia, a venue widely celebrated for its rich baseball heritage. This will mark the first occasion that a Perfect Game event is held at this iconic ballpark, which has previously hosted numerous historic baseball events, including three World Series.

Scheduled for Sunday, August 16, 2026, at 5:00 PM ET, the Classic will coincide with the United States’ 250th birthday, adding an extra layer of significance to this momentous occasion. Delegated to honor America's sporting legacy, Philadelphia — often called the birthplace of the nation — is an apt choice for the event. This will be the first time the DICK'S All-American Classic is hosted on the East Coast since 2005, when it occurred in Aberdeen, Maryland.

This annual showcase gathers top high school baseball players from across the country, many of whom climb the ranks to become first-round MLB Draft picks or standout major leaguers. It provides a unique platform where these emerging athletes can display their talents in front of extensive crowds, coaches, and professional scouts.

"Bringing the DICK'S All-American Classic to Philadelphia is a milestone moment for Perfect Game," remarked Perfect Game Chairman Rick Thurman. He emphasized the significance of holding a flagship event in Philadelphia, especially during a commemorative year for America. The stadium’s environment, paired with its historical importance, presents an unparalleled backdrop to celebrate the burgeoning talents of America's next baseball superstars.

In addition, former Philadelphia Phillies manager Charlie Manuel has been appointed the Honorary Chairman of the All-American Classic. Manuel is celebrated as the winningest manager in Phillies history, steering the team to two back-to-back National League pennants (2008-09) and clinching the 2008 World Series. "Philadelphia will always hold a special place in my heart," stated Manuel. He expressed his pride in assuming this honorary role amid a significant anniversary for the nation, highlighting the city’s passionate fan base and baseball legacy.

Previous editions of the DICK'S All-American Classic have taken place at notable venues including Petco Park in San Diego, Dodger Stadium in Los Angeles, and Chase Field in Phoenix. Renowned alumni include top-tier players like Bryce Harper, Zack Wheeler, and Francisco Lindor, showcasing a track record of excellence associated with this event.
